Compare all specifications:

1952 Allard K2 1973 Ginetta G15
Make Allard Ginetta
Model K2 G15
Year Released 1952 1973
Engine Position Front Middle
Engine Size 3622 cc 875 cc
Engine Cylinders 8 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type V in-line
Horse Power 85 HP 51 HP
Engine RPM 3600 RPM 6100 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Number of Seats 3 seats 2 seats
Vehicle Length 4270 mm 3660 mm
Vehicle Width 1810 mm 1450 mm
